982 in Roman numerals

The number 982 (nine hundred eighty-two) is written in Roman numerals as follows: CMLXXXII

The Roman numbering system (Roman numerals) was created in Ancient Rome, and was used throughout the Roman Empire. It consists of seven capital letters of the Latin alphabet: I, V, X, L, C, D and M.
